Title: Ralf Heinen: Innovator in Textile Finishing Technologies
Introduction
Ralf Heinen is a notable inventor based in Köln, Germany, recognized for his contributions to textile finishing technologies. With a total of four patents to his name, Heinen has made significant advancements in the field, particularly in processes that enhance the properties of wool and other textile materials.
Latest Patents
One of Heinen's latest patents is for a process that produces nonfelting wool through a combination of plasma treatment and wet chemical finishing. This innovative approach allows for the creation of nonfelting wool in a technically simple and easily manageable manner. Another significant patent involves acid-resistant solutions containing aromatic formaldehyde condensation products. This invention focuses on the preparation and application of these solutions as leveling agents, dispersants, and fastness improvers in textile finishing, as well as tanning agents for leather.
